Florida man arrested after beachfront chase in Waveland
WAVELAND, Miss. (WXXV)-Waveland police say a Florida man is facing multiple charges after leading officers on a short chase along the beach. Police say an officer tried to pull over a Jeep traveling 44 miles per hour in a 25 mile per hour zone on South Beach Boulevard Tuesday night.
Hundreds line up for Leon County food distribution, some arriving as early as 3...
LEON COUNTY, Fla. -- Hundreds of cars lined up outside the Leon County Sheriff’s Office on the morning of a community food distribution event, with one family arriving around 3 a.m. to secure a spot in line — a turnout officials said reflects a growing need across Leon County.

Tallahassee blueberry farm recovers after exceptional drought
Sienna Lee Gardens blueberry farm had a successful U-pick harvest despite an exceptional drought that dried up lakes, soil, and crops in Tallahassee.
Gretna church hosts free summer food distribution for families in need
A free summer food program is now running every Tuesday at Springfield AME Church in Gretna for the next 11 weeks.
